Some of Samia Sultans neighbours dont greet her any more, and sometimes its hard for her to understand why. Sultan, a dentist, lives in Glasgow, in an area of the city that is like most Muslim populations in the UK majority Sunni. But Sultan isnt Sunni: she is Ahmadi. And that is the source of the problem.
My neighbours were fine, but when they came to know I was Ahmadi, their attitude changed, Sultan explains....They would no longer reply to my greeting As-salāmu alaykum [peace be upon you] with Waalaykumu s-salām [and upon you peace].
When Asad Shah, a popular shopkeeper living in the multicultural Shawlands area of Glasgow, was fatally stabbed outside his newsagents on the night before Good Friday, the initial local presumption was that this had been a white-on-black hate crime...But it soon emerged that Police Scotland were treating the crime as religiously prejudiced, an unusually specific form of words, and that Shah was an Ahmadi, a member of a minority sect of Islam that faces persecution and bloody violence in countries such as Pakistan and Indonesia, and is treated with open hostility by many orthodox Muslims in the UK because it differs from their belief that Muhammad is the final prophet sent to guide humankind, as orthodox Muslims believe is laid out in the Quran.
The man now charged with Shahs murder is also a Muslim. On Thursday, Tanveer Ahmed, from Bradford, released a statement through his lawyer, justifying the killing because Shah had disrespected Islam.
A posting on the Facebook page Anti Qadianiat (Tahafuz Khatme Nubuwwat), included the Guardians report of Shahs death, with the message Congratulations to all Muslims.
